Section 12:17-4.2 - Reporting to file an initial or reopened claim

Universal Citation: NJ Admin Code 12:17-4.2

Current through Register Vol. 56, No. 6, March 18, 2024

(a) An individual shall telephone a Reemployment Call Center or contact the Division via an Internet application to file an initial claim for benefits, unless another method of filing is prescribed by the Division. The effective date of an initial claim for benefits is the Sunday of the week in which the claimant first reports to claim benefits. The effective date of the initial claim establishes the period of time during which wages may be used to determine the monetary eligibility.

(b) Each claimant may reopen his or her claim any time during the 52-week period after first filing a claim, by reporting by telephone or via an Internet application to a Reemployment Call Center or as the Division may otherwise prescribe. The effective date of a reopened claim for benefits is the Sunday of the week in which the claimant first reports to the Reemployment Call Center to claim benefits.

(c) A claimant who returns to full-time work for more than one calendar week and then becomes unemployed shall report by telephone or via an Internet application to the Reemployment Call Center, or as the Division may otherwise prescribe, to reopen the claim. The claim shall be reopened as of the week in which the claimant first reports to claim benefits.
